The mission of the Australian Federal Police is to provide dynamic and effective law enforcement to the people of Australia. It provides policing throughout Australia in relation to the prevention and detection of crimes against the Commonwealth, its laws and integrity, and community police services to the Community of the ACT.

What is the role?
Applications are sought from suitably qualified applicants wishing to be considered for the exciting and rewarding role of Social Media Officer.

Working closely with the high achieving AFP National Media team you will work to promote and protect the AFP by highlighting operational successes and capabilities on social media platforms.

The content delivered supports the agency’s media and communications intent to deliver value to the AFP and the community by deterring crime and encouraging the public to report crime, building trust with the public to gain better operational intelligence, and explaining to the community how and why the AFP use legislation.

This role will work under the direction and guidance of Team Leader National Media and directly with other Social Media Officers to create and publish innovative and creative content to increase awareness, growth and engagement across the platforms.

You will also be required to contribute to the achievement of outcomes in accordance with the regulatory framework, the AFP Code of Conduct and the AFP Governance Instruments. It is expected that the successful applicant will deliver on the core responsibilities and meet any requirements of the position as outlined below.

What will you do?
The Social Media Team focuses on delivering targeted social media content for AFP operations so the organisation can maintain a strong link with the community and stay a step ahead of criminals who seek to harm Australians and Australia’s interests.

We are seeking a highly motivated, innovative and creative thinker who can work cooperatively to enhance our social media platforms.

This role will help the creation, planning and scheduling of content for platforms including Facebook, Instagram, X, YouTube and LinkedIn.

This role attracts a composite allowance in recognition of expanded working hours, normal patterns of attendance and shift patterns (such as afternoon shifts, weekends and Designated Public Holidays) that are required under the Operations working pattern. In accordance with the AFP Enterprise Agreement, an employee who is required to work in accordance with the Operations working pattern will receive a Core Composite of 22% in addition to their base salary, which will count as salary for superannuation. The Commissioner has the authority to remove a composite from a role.
